What's included

  • Supply and fit of a smart 7kW (32A) charger, or 22kW where you have three-phase
  • Dedicated RCD-protected circuit with the right cable for the run
  • Load management so the charger backs off if the house is drawing hard
  • App, tariff and scheduled-charging setup before we go
  • Notification and certificate for the new circuit
  • OZEV grant claim handled for eligible renters, flat owners and landlords

As an OZEV-authorised installer we fit only approved chargepoints to BS 7671 and the IET Code of Practice. From April 2026 the EV chargepoint grant is worth up to £500 per socket for renters, flat owners and landlords — homeowners with a driveway are not eligible, so we will tell you honestly whether a grant applies.

Can I get the government grant?

If you rent your home, own a flat, or are a landlord you can claim up to £500 per socket and we handle the claim. Homeowners with off-street parking are not eligible — the scheme changed in 2022.

Which charger should I choose?

For most homes a 7kW smart charger is the right call. We fit Ohme, Zappi, Hypervolt and Pod Point and will match the unit to your car, tariff and how you charge.
